Steps for Mint shrimp salad

  • Make Mint shrimp salad step 0
    1
    Eight shrimps
  • Make Mint shrimp salad step 1
    2
    One hundred grams of raw vegetables you like
  • Make Mint shrimp salad step 2
    3
    Four crab sticks
  • Make Mint shrimp salad step 3
    4
    Take the leaves of five mints, wash them clean and dry, and cut them around
  • Make Mint shrimp salad step 4
    5
    apple vinegar 10ml, lemon juice 5ml, olive oil 5ml, salt 1,5ml, now grinding black peppers into juice
  • Make Mint shrimp salad step 5
    6
    Put on mint leaves, sauce, full mix.
  • Mint shrimp salad Make Tips

    This is a single serving. If you like a more lemony taste, you can add another 5ml of lemon juice. If you don't have crab sticks, you can add more shrimp. If you don't have apple cider vinegar, you can substitute it with red wine vinegar or lemon juice. (I haven't tried Chinese vinegar, so I'm not sure if the taste will be weird.
